Abstract
We show that two linearly polarized counterpropagating waves in a Kerr nonlinear medium with linear dispersion can exhibit multimode temporal instability. We find the boundary of the unstable regime and demonstrate that the fully developed instability results in self-sustained oscillations and the onset of chaos.
